Games Ground Berlin


In November 2024, we made our second appearance at a Games Ground Berlin.

This time their crew doubled down on XR and created a whole area called "the XR dungeon”

A perfect context with strong cyberpunk aesthetics.

This vibrant community of indie game developers welcomed us with open arms and upgraded the playground area to explore a large menu of cyberdelic experiences.

Apart from the epic lineup of experiences we were also granted the opportunity to give 2 presentations at the Cage Stage.

  • Jose Montemayor Alba spoke on Reimagining Reality: Gaming as a Catalyst for Personal Growth, where he explored Infinite Game Theory and gaming’s potential to foster empathy, creativity, and transformative thinking.
  • Edo Fouilloux dynamic talk, “Can Building Games and Worlds Feel Like Jamming in a Garage Band?” showcased how collaborative creation and sandbox gaming are reshaping the landscape of interactive fun.

    He gave a live multiplayer demo showcasing the power of Patch World.

Cyberdelic Showcase Berlin & CSB Branch Inauguration: A New Chapter Begins


The week after Games Ground, we hosted a groundbreaking Cyberdelic Showcase at Cambridge Innovation Campus Berlin, uniting pioneers in AI, XR, and consciousness exploration.

The evening featured a thought-provoking panel discussion with thought leaders from Immersia Labs, Sensiks, Cyberdelic Nexus, Museum of Consciousness and Dreamseed VR.

Followed by a collaborative Think Tank lead by Bradley C. Royes focused on developing Berlin's cyberdelic culture through a month-long Cyberdelic City residency program.

Visitors experienced an array of immersive installations including EEG-powered art, sound frequency body massage, consciousness-expanding VR experiences, AI-generated digital art, and a non-alcoholic nootropics bar with an AI bartender.

The showcase also planted the seeds for the Cyberdelic Society Berlin Branch initiative led by Mars Vertigo and Bradley C Royes.

This expansion of our global network brings exciting new possibilities for us to prove that Cyberdelic Societies can successfully branch around the world.
